Flesh and Blood

The Church of England is backing a groundbreaking new campaign was launched today specifically calling on the church to increase the number of blood and organ donors in the UK.

The Rt Rev James Newcome is Lead Bishop on Healthcare for the Church of England and Chair of the National Stewardship Committee. Bishop James says, “fleshandblood is an exciting opportunity for the church. Christians have a mandate to heal, motivated by compassion, mercy, knowledge and ability. Extending our understanding of the central Christian themes of generosity and stewardship to include blood and organ donation has the potential to tangibly transform the giver and the receiver. The benefit to others is not only life enhancing but can mean the difference between life and death.” 

fleshandblood.org is a hub of free resources, stories and media: providing information and practical ideas for churches and communities to engage with the campaign.
